How Nimsy 100mg Tablet DT works:
Nimsy 100mg Delayed-Release Tablets contain a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ID) that inhibits the production of inflammatory mediators, thus alleviating pain and reducing associated swelling and redness.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Alcohol consumption alongside Nimsy 100mg Tablet DT is inadvisable.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Using Nimsy 100mg DT tablets during pregnancy poses a confirmed risk to the fetus. While generally contraindicated, a physician might exceptionally prescribe it in critical circumstances where the potential life-saving benefits outweigh the known dangers. Always se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Data on the compatibility of Nimsy 100mg Tablet DT with breastfeeding is currently lacking. Seek medical advice from your physician.
Driving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Driving ability may be affected by Nimsy 100mg Tablet DT; however, this effect is undetermined. Refrain from driving if experiencing symptoms impairing concentration or reaction time.
KidneyCAUTION
Exercise caution when administering Nimsy 100mg Tablet DT to individuals with impaired renal function; dosage modification may be necessary. Consult a physician before use. Nimsy 100mg Tablet DT is contraindicated in patients exhibiting severe kidney disease.
LiverUNSAFE
The use of Nimsy 100mg Tablet DT is potentially hazardous for individuals with hepatic impairment and is best avoided. Medical advice is recommended.
What if you forget to take Nimsy 100mg Tablet DT :
Should you forget a Nimsy 100mg Tablet DT dose, administer it immediately. If, however, your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
